Anna is a Tampa-based Board Certified Behavior Analyst and former Professor of Education with two decades of experience supporting individuals with complex needs across educational, medical, and clinical settings.
Before entering clinical practice, she spent 10 years in public special education — earning the Cheers to PUBlic Service Award for her lasting impact on students and families. She later developed a spinal cord injury prevention curriculum at the Shepherd Center that remains in use today.
She founded this practice to meet a growing need: accessible, high-quality ABA from a provider who truly understands school systems, collaborates meaningfully, and leads with compassion.

A clear path from inquiry to care.
We are a concierge-style ABA practice committed to thoughtful, individualized care for each child and family. To ensure an excellent fit, we follow a clear, structured intake process.
Submit an Inquiry
Complete our brief inquiry form so we can learn about your child, your family's goals, and your scheduling needs. Within 1–2 business days, we follow up via email to review service availability, insurance and private-pay options, location and scheduling logistics, and whether we're the right fit.
Choose Your Consultation
Based on your needs, select from a Brief Strategy Consultation or a Comprehensive Intake Consultation. Both are designed to give you clarity, direction, and practical next steps — whether or not you continue with ongoing services.
Service Planning & Onboarding
If we mutually determine ongoing services are appropriate, we develop a formal service plan, initiate insurance authorization when applicable, coordinate scheduling and staffing, and begin with an orientation session for you and your team.
